.buttons-module-section,.buttons-module-section .buttons{display:flex;justify-content:center}.buttons-module-section .buttons{align-items:stretch;flex-wrap:wrap;gap:16px;max-width:855px;width:100%}.buttons-module-section .buttons a{align-items:center;background-color:#e8eaea;color:#007dc3;display:inline-flex;flex:1 1 100%;font-family:Thicker!important;font-size:20px!important;font-weight:700!important;justify-content:center;min-height:56px;min-width:0;overflow:hidden;text-align:center;text-decoration:none;text-overflow:ellipsis;transition:.3s ease;white-space:nowrap}.buttons-module-section .buttons a:hover{color:#000}@media (min-width:520px){.buttons-module-section .buttons a{flex:0 0 100%;min-height:72px}}@media (min-width:900px){.buttons-module-section .buttons{gap:20px}.buttons-module-section .buttons a{flex:0 1 270px;min-height:90px}}